Wow! Have seen some vintage Heuer's go for some crazy money, but that wins first prize.  The line about McQueen wearing a Heuer made it a favorite among racing drivers is off the mark.  They were already popular with racer's, Fangio often wore one.  McQueen liked the Heuer Autavia that Jo Siffert wore, that's how he ended up wearing the Monaco.  Siffert Autavia's are among the most desired by vintage Heuer collectors.
